Description
The number of cluster alerts does not always correspond to the other available alerts numbers. Moreover those numbers not always correspond with actual state of the cluster.
E.g.
- I had 2 as number of alerts on Clusters page, whilst related Volumes and Hosts shows all 0. The same for the alert list.
- In another case I had 1 alert on the Clusters, related Volumes and Hosts shows all 0 and Alerts list shows 3 active alerts.
In both cases the cluster was completely up and running.
Reproduction steps:
- kill some bricks, let the tendrl notice (especially there should be alert about degraded state of a volume)
- stop glusterd services on all nodes and wait few seconds
- start glusterd services on all nodes so all bricks are running again
- If needed repeat previous steps (in my case just stopping and starting glusterd was enough)
